Output 21a6d1266ca9fe880daf622405d37a34b3270c0e84c9d6ac1761ba8b7d6f0f9e:0

value
167973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b891a1a38f35ab3159b202aebdecca9d4e364c8c OP_EQUAL
address
3JWviVF3r8Zn8w4xPe7PJKsmRzm9WieWWr
transaction
21a6d1266ca9fe880daf622405d37a34b3270c0e84c9d6ac1761ba8b7d6f0f9e
confirmations
429717
spent
true